CSS Framework - с полки или доморощенный? - PullRequest
3 голосов
/ 18 июня 2009

Существует ли существующий фреймворк, который удовлетворяет потребности ваших проектов с небольшими изменениями, или вы разработали свой собственный? Что вы рекомендуете для тех, кто пытается принять это решение с этими приоритетами:

  1. CSS reset
  2. Внимание к типографике; базовая сетка
  3. Семантические занятия
  4. Доступность
  5. Много классов "Помощник": например, .demphasized, .errormsg, .readmore и т. д.
  6. Сетка, если она не конфликтует с # 3

Не приоритет: - Жидкость / Эластичный макет - Введите ems /% s

Заранее спасибо.

Ответы [ 4 ]

2 голосов
/ 18 июня 2009

Никаких рамок там не будет делать все, что вы хотите.

Но Blueprint должно хватить, чтобы начать работу.

0 голосов
/ 17 апреля 2012

Я рекомендую вам Siimpler это простая HTML-структура с готовой структурой файлов / папок, но вы можете настроить ее для своих нужд. Для опыта Вы можете выбрать между сбросом CSS и Normalize.css.

0 голосов
/ 17 июля 2009

Elastic css framework может делать это почти все, что угодно, кроме baseline (пока), но вы можете интегрировать его, включая baseline.css, полученный наasticss.com.

Никаких загадочных имен классов, поддержка классов объединения, центрирование по x и y, одинаковая высота, дружественная к SEO (поддержка шаблонов и адаптивных макетов)

много вспомогательных классов, и определенно не навязчиво с вашими классами, или абсолютное позиционирование. все бесплатно и для всех браузеров :) надеюсь, вам понравится.

и да, он поддерживает фиксированные, плавные, эластичные макеты, и вы можете просто комбинировать их, чтобы получить более сложные вещи, вы также получаете неограниченное вложение, поэтому эластичный не подведет вас после первого уровня

0 голосов
/ 18 июня 2009

Мне удалось продвинуться довольно далеко с этими:

960 Сетка для макетов

Blueprint

CSS-структура jQuery UI

YAML

...